Keith Urban ’s return to social media landed with the kind of dramatic timing only life after a high-profile split can deliver.
The country star reappeared online after nearly two months of silence, posting a lighthearted promo for his new reality series “The Road” — and fans immediately locked in on the real headline: he finally broke his silence after actress Nicole Kidman filed for divorce and after he admitted on the show that he’d been “completely lonely and miserable.”
But beneath the jokes about his past hairstyles, fans couldn’t ignore the emotional thread Urban’s already revealed on the show — especially when he admitted that performing on the road had left him “lonely and miserable.”
